Soon after the BCCI lifted the ban on Hardik Pandya after Koffee With Karan 6 fiasco, the Indian all-rounder joined the team and was including in the playing XI for the 3rd ODI against New Zealand at the Oval Bay in Mount Maunganui. The all-rounder even picked a couple of wickets and looked in form after being included in the squad. He also took a stunning catch and sent Kane Williamson packing to the pavilion. Pandya bowled a short delivery to Ross Taylor and the Kiwi batsman pulled it to short mid-wicket. Dhawan was the man in the same position collected the ball but lost his balance and threw the ball away from the fielders. After the match, Virat Kohli said, “Amazing, three clinical games from us, the relentlessness of the side pleasing. Haven't had a break for a while, hectic Australia tour and now this. We are three-nil up so I can relax a little. Some outstanding talent coming through. Saw Shubman batting in the nets, I wasn't even 10 percent of that at 19.”
